"Mainiac" meaning in English

See Mainiac in All languages combined, or Wiktionary

Noun

Forms: Mainiacs [plural]
Etymology: Blend of Maine + maniac. Etymology templates: {{blend|en|Maine|maniac}} Blend of Maine + maniac Head templates: {{en-noun}} Mainiac (plural Mainiacs)
  1. (humorous) A Mainer; someone from the U.S. state of Maine. Tags: humorous
